Vermont Grown Pork We now offer natural bacon, ham and sausages made from pork naturally grown here in Vermont and we're excited about it! The pigs live on pasture during much of the year and in barns with deep bedded packs during the winter and early spring. They eat only grains and legumes, minerals and pasture or hay. Farrowing crates aren't used. These are happy, healthy pigs. Excellent Smoked Meats and Sausages for All Craftsmanship and great flavor have earned us a fine reputation here in Vermont. Processing Services for Farmers We make delicious smoked meats and fresh sausages from the hogs, turkeys and beef over 600 Vermont farmers bring us each year. From part-timers with one hog in the backyard to full-time farmers selling in farmers markets, to CSA (Community Supported Agriculture) customers and in stores, their meats all get the same ‘damn fine’ smoking. Below are some of the farmers we smoke meats for under USDA inspection. Custom Smoking Services For farmers wishing to bring us meats for smoking on a custom (for home consumption and not for sale; made outside of USDA inspected hours, but using the same food safety protocols) basis, here are the basics: • PLEASE NOTE: please call ahead to book an appointment during the busy fall season. An appointment will be required until further notice. • Bring in your meat fresh or frozen, wrapped in butcher paper or in clear plastic (not black plastic, that isn’t healthy and the USDA forbids it), in a sturdy box. (If you don’t, we’ll have to charge you to do it after it arrives). • We’re located in the back half of the D&D Smokehouse and Deli (aka the Shell Station (don’t laugh, remember that other Vermont food company that started out in a gas station (the ice cream guys)). Our door faces the gas pumps and says “Receiving” over the top of it. From I-89, Exit 6, 4.5 miles down the hill to the intersection of VT Routes 14 and 63. Shell station is on your right. • We’re open from 8 to 5, Monday through Friday. Just stop in and ring the doorbell. • We’ll call you the following Monday or Tuesday morning to let you know it is time to pick up your ham, bacon or other treats. • Brining & Smoking fee is $1.00 per lb on the fresh weight. We offer bacon slicing and vacuum packing only for USDA-inspected processing. • We use the same brine and smoke as our bacon and ham that you can buy in the stores! • Please email or call with other questions.
